DdS may well be a top class 2 mile chaser a d win the QMCC next year. However the times of his races have to be a concern. I know times arent everything but all pf the open G1 races he contested were slower then the other races on the same card.
The Shloer was run 2 seconds slower than the arkle trial won by PTKO on the same day over the same cd.
The Tingle Creek was slower than the novice G1 won by Esprit du Large on the same day over the same cd.
The ascot chase was slower than 2m4f handicappers ran their final 2 miles on the same day.
The QMCC was 2 seconds slower than the Arkle over the same cd even though it was run on faster ground.
The general opinion os that DdS had an off day in the QMCC, my view is that it was the fastest pace he has been forced to jump at and his jumping let him down on the day.
There seems to be a pattern that the open G1 races last year were of poor quality, there is no way a Un de Sceaux at his peak would run a slower time over 2m than handicappers running a half mile more. I think he has it all to prove over 2 miles against better opposition.
I hope PTKO takes him on in the Shloer and sets a fast pace and puts pressure on his jumping and we will see what both are made of.if its run at a sedate pace I would fancy DdS to win a sprint from the bottom of the hill, if run at a fast pace I think PTKO could have the race in safe keeping after the 2nd last. Will be interesting in any case, and we should learn a lot from it.
